The Office of the Academic Registrar at Makerere University has released the undergraduate admission lists for Privately sponsored students for the Academic Year 2024-2025. The lists also include names of students admitted to Makerere University Business School (Mubs).
The list comprises names of A-Level applicants who had applied for various academic programs or courses, and have been successful, meeting the requirements for admission to the country’s premier institution of higher learning.
With thousands applying to study at Makerere University and other top public universities, education institutions use cut-off points to decide who gets admitted to what academic program and who misses out on what course.
“The Ministry of Education and Sports (MoES) through the Public Universities Joint Admissions Board (PUJAB) releases fresh cut-off points every academic year for Academic Programmes under the Government Sponsorship Scheme,” explains Makerere University.
“Additionally, the Office of the Academic Registrar, Makerere University in turn releases fresh cut-off points every academic year for Academic Programmes under the Private Sponsorship Scheme.”
